python随机生成奇数的方法:

实现思路:

1、需要用到random模块

2、用列表展现给用户

3、检查这个数是否为奇数,在用append的方法将为奇数的随机数写入列表中

4、为了保证能输入与用户输入的整数相同个数的奇数,选择使用whlie结构

实现代码:import random #导入random模块

NUM = int(input('请输入一个整数:')) #提示用户输入一个整数

list1 = [] #设置一个空列表用于展示用户需要的数据

while len(list1) < NUM: #确保输出的数据是用户需要的个数,并循环输出

a = random.randint(1,1000000) #随机生成1-1000000之间的一个整数

if a % 2 ==1: #判断随机生成的数是否为奇数,如果为奇数执行下面的代码

list1.append(a) #向空列表中加入随机生成的奇数

print(list1) #向用户展示生成的奇数

python学习网,免费的在线学习python平台,欢迎关注!

python随机奇数_python怎么随机生成奇数相关推荐

  1. 怎样用python随机生成100内的100个奇数_python怎么随机生成奇数_后端开发

    PHP每15分钟自动更新网站地图(减少服务器消耗)_后端开发 sitemap.php为页面文件,sitemap.html为sitemap.php的克隆版,监控宝设置定时监控timeSitemap.ph ...

  2. python随机生成10个奇数_python怎么随机生成奇数

    python随机生成奇数的方法: 实现思路: 1.需要用到random模块 2.用列表展现给用户 3.检查这个数是否为奇数,在用append的方法将为奇数的随机数写入列表中 4.为了保证能输入与用户输 ...

  3. python随机生成奇数_python怎么随机生成奇数_后端开发

    PHP每15分钟自动更新网站地图(减少服务器消耗)_后端开发 sitemap.php为页面文件,sitemap.html为sitemap.php的克隆版,监控宝设置定时监控timeSitemap.ph ...

  4. python 随机排序_Python 如何随机打乱列表(List)排序

    场景: 现在有一个list:[1,2,3,4,5,6],我需要把这个list在输出的时候,是以一种随机打乱的形式输出. 专业点的术语:将一个容器中的数据每次随机逐个遍历一遍. 注意:不是生成一个随机的 ...

  5. python怎么输出所有奇数_python输出100以内奇数的几种输出方式-Go语言中文社区

    自从看了一些Python的一些基础语言之后,发现Python这门语言还是蛮有趣啊,很多计算用Python效率还是蛮高啊,几行就搞定了.比方说输出100以内的奇数,用其他语言,可能都是先for循环遍历1 ...

  6. python红包程序_Python写随机发红包的原理流程

    首先来说说要用到的知识点,第一个要说的是扩展包random,random模块一般用来生成一个随机数 今天要用到ramdom中unifrom的方法用于生成一个指定范围的随机浮点数通过下面的图简单看下: ...

  7. python判断偶数奇数_Python程序检查数字是奇数还是偶数

    python判断偶数奇数 Here you will get python program to check number is odd or even. 在这里,您将获得python程序以检查数字是 ...

  8. python画树林_python对随机森林分类结果绘制roc曲线

    上图: 附上代码:一个函数,传入三个参数 .....传入参数,训练模型,然后: fit = model.fit(x_train, y_training) # ROC y_score = model.f ...

  9. 浙大python读者验证码_Python实现简单生成验证码功能【基于random模块】

    本文实例讲述了Python实现简单生成验证码功能.分享给大家供大家参考,具体如下: 验证码一般用来验证登陆.交易等行为,减少对端为机器操作的概率,python中可以使用random模块,char()内 ...

最新文章

  1. 编程能力差,学不好Python、AI、Java等技术,90%是输在了这点上!
  2. 计算机英语发展历史,英语翻译计算机发展史,领域与未来发展 一、计算机发展史简介 人类所使用的计算工具是随着生产的发展和社会的进步,从简单到复...
  3. std::chrono时间库详解
  4. 洛谷P1019 单词接龙
  5. 我要3万取款机怎么取_7万的新宝骏RS-3怎么样?用车三个月后,车主说出了实话...
  6. 罗莎琳德·富兰克林:隐于幕后的DNA之母,以及她被误解却又伟大的短暂一生...
  7. @ConfigurationProperties 在IDEA中出现红色波浪线问题
  8. 【干货】Python编程惯例
  9. 通过反射访问private的属性或方法
  10. Migrations有两个文件迁移数据的方法
  11. 计算机应用网络工程师的英文名字,网络工程师英文简历
  12. jQuery简单好用的JavaScript代码库略解使用
  13. 010 editor 应用templates分析ELF和dex文件
  14. 怎么给word文档注音_怎么为整篇word文字添加拼音标注
  15. 【新手上路常见问答】关于物联网设计
  16. 常用的几种向量运算法则
  17. AVAudioPlayer 播放本地音乐
  18. python英雄对战代码_Python爬虫获取op.gg英雄联盟英雄对位胜率代码
  19. 树的最小表示法 UVA 12489 - Combating cancer
  20. ESXi 7.0主机 查看硬盘SMART健康信息

热门文章

  1. 蓝湖完成 10 亿元 C+ 轮融资,发布一站式产品设计协作工具
  2. 2000以内!一加Nord 2渲染图曝光:搭载联发科天玑1200
  3. 外媒:新iPhone系列配备更大无线充电线圈 反向无线充即将到来
  4. 数百台湾人把名字改成“鲑鱼”去吃免费日料,结果有人改不回来了
  5. 一加9系列全网预约量破200万:3月24日见!
  6. 月薪23333元!淘宝招募“首席鉴雕官”,只需天天哈哈哈哈哈
  7. 苹果公司官方证实,iPhone12延期!
  8. 《和平精英》崩了 官方回应:受运营商网络波动影响 正在修复
  9. 入门机却拥有旗舰级音质体验 Redmi红米8系列音频信息曝光
  10. 小米MIX 4概念渲染图曝光:无孔屏下摄像头果真科幻